RemoteIoT VPCSH using Raspberry Pi on AWS Free Tier has become one of the most sought-after solutions for tech enthusiasts and developers alike. As cloud computing continues to grow in popularity, leveraging AWS services for IoT projects has never been easier or more cost-effective. In this article, we will delve into the world of RemoteIoT, VPCSH, and how Raspberry Pi can be integrated seamlessly with AWS Free Tier to create robust IoT applications.
Whether you're a hobbyist looking to experiment with IoT or a professional developer exploring scalable cloud solutions, this guide will provide you with everything you need to know. From setting up your Raspberry Pi to deploying it on AWS, we'll cover all the essential steps in detail.
This article is designed to be a comprehensive resource for anyone interested in building IoT projects using RemoteIoT VPCSH. We'll explore the technical aspects, share valuable insights, and provide actionable steps to help you get started. Let's dive in!
Read also:Mothers Warmth Jackerman Chapter 3 A Journey Of Love And Resilience
Table of Contents:
- Introduction to RemoteIoT VPCSH
- Understanding Raspberry Pi
- AWS Free Tier Overview
- Setting Up Raspberry Pi for AWS
- What is VPCSH and Why Use It?
- Exploring RemoteIoT
- Integrating Raspberry Pi with AWS
- Ensuring Security in Your IoT Project
- Best Practices for RemoteIoT VPCSH
- Conclusion and Next Steps
Introduction to RemoteIoT VPCSH
RemoteIoT VPCSH represents the next generation of cloud-based IoT solutions. By combining the power of cloud computing with the flexibility of IoT devices, developers can create scalable and secure applications that cater to a wide range of industries. The VPCSH architecture ensures that your IoT projects are isolated, secure, and optimized for performance.
Why Choose AWS for IoT Projects?
AWS offers a wide range of services tailored specifically for IoT projects, making it an ideal platform for developers. With features like AWS IoT Core, AWS Lambda, and Amazon S3, you can build, deploy, and manage IoT applications with ease. Additionally, the AWS Free Tier provides an excellent opportunity for beginners to experiment with cloud services without incurring costs.
Understanding Raspberry Pi
The Raspberry Pi is a compact, affordable single-board computer that has revolutionized the way we approach hardware development. Its versatility and ease of use make it a favorite among hobbyists and professionals alike. When paired with AWS, the Raspberry Pi becomes a powerful tool for building IoT applications.
Key Features of Raspberry Pi
- Compact size and lightweight design
- Support for multiple operating systems
- GPIO pins for interfacing with sensors and actuators
- Low power consumption
AWS Free Tier Overview
The AWS Free Tier is a great starting point for anyone looking to explore cloud computing. It provides access to a wide range of AWS services, including those specifically designed for IoT projects. By leveraging the Free Tier, you can experiment with AWS services without worrying about costs, making it an ideal choice for beginners.
Benefits of AWS Free Tier
- 12 months of free access to AWS services
- Generous usage limits for essential services
- Perfect for learning and prototyping
Setting Up Raspberry Pi for AWS
Setting up your Raspberry Pi for use with AWS involves several key steps. From installing the necessary software to configuring network settings, this section will guide you through the entire process.
Read also:Eric Winter Biography Movies And Tv Shows
Step-by-Step Guide
- Install the latest version of Raspberry Pi OS
- Configure Wi-Fi and network settings
- Install AWS CLI and configure credentials
What is VPCSH and Why Use It?
VPCSH, or Virtual Private Cloud Security Hub, is a crucial component of AWS that ensures the security and isolation of your IoT projects. By using VPCSH, you can create a secure environment for your applications, protecting them from potential threats.
Key Benefits of VPCSH
- Isolated network environment
- Enhanced security features
- Scalability and flexibility
Exploring RemoteIoT
RemoteIoT refers to the ability to control and monitor IoT devices from a remote location. By leveraging cloud services like AWS, you can create robust applications that allow you to interact with your devices in real-time, regardless of their physical location.
Use Cases for RemoteIoT
- Smart home automation
- Industrial IoT applications
- Agricultural monitoring systems
Integrating Raspberry Pi with AWS
Integrating your Raspberry Pi with AWS involves connecting the device to the cloud and configuring it to communicate with AWS services. This section will provide a detailed guide on how to achieve this integration.
Steps to Integrate
- Set up AWS IoT Core
- Configure MQTT communication
- Deploy Lambda functions for data processing
Ensuring Security in Your IoT Project
Security is a critical aspect of any IoT project. By implementing best practices and leveraging AWS security features, you can ensure that your applications are protected from potential threats.
Security Best Practices
- Use strong authentication mechanisms
- Encrypt data in transit and at rest
- Regularly update firmware and software
Best Practices for RemoteIoT VPCSH
To get the most out of your RemoteIoT VPCSH setup, it's essential to follow best practices. This section will provide actionable tips and recommendations to help you optimize your IoT projects.
Tips for Success
- Plan your architecture carefully
- Monitor performance and usage metrics
- Stay updated with the latest AWS features
Conclusion and Next Steps
In conclusion, RemoteIoT VPCSH using Raspberry Pi on AWS Free Tier offers a powerful and cost-effective solution for IoT projects. By following the steps outlined in this article, you can create robust applications that leverage the full potential of cloud computing and IoT technologies.
We encourage you to take action and start building your own IoT projects. Leave a comment below to share your experiences or ask any questions. Don't forget to explore other articles on our site for more insights and tutorials. Happy coding!


